Those who are alcohol dependent and are going through alcohol detox are susceptible to a number of risky symptoms including mild to severe seizures, and also delirium tremens (DT's). These more dangerous symptoms could be life-threatening, particularly DT's which is the most severe form of alcohol withdrawal which results from abrupt and severe mental and nervous system changes. DT's and seizures can happen even if someone has what would possibly be considered a moderate quantity of alcohol daily for a number of months. Six or eight beers on a daily basis for several months could do it, as an example. One can never be too careful.
